DEFENCE OF SWEDEN. '
CUTTING DOWN THE FORCES. STOCKHOLM. May 27. The Riksdag, by a substantia] majority j agreed to the recommendations of a Parliamentary commit toe substantially idertI tiral with the bill submitted by tlin jpresent Labour flovcrnmrnt in February, providing fur a transition period, after which tlic anntinl cost of all Sweden! defences will amount to ninety-six mil - lion krnner, rompnred with one lmndreil and ninpty-onn million Kroner in 11)11. Tlir> providr that thn army sliml! bo reduced to twi>nty regiments of infantry, four i>f i-avulry ;irnl ?cven of artillery. The navy mid air force nre unaltered at present, but the naval programme will" be in )!»iS. iH.-nter.) j
